The continuing investment by the Dutch owned producer based at Thakeham, West Sussex, reached its latest stage last month with the completion of a £250,000 temperature regulated, high/low preparation area, which is already operational.

The facility is based on Heveco's own farm which produces 80 tonnes weekly to provide a guaranteed fresh supply of product.

This development is central to the long-term strategy which brings an added dimension to Heveco's product portfolio. The washing, slicing and dicing operation can handle more than a tonne of mushrooms an hour. The unit has been designed to high-care food standards but also with flexibility in mind, to allow multiple orders to specific customer requirements to be completed quickly and cost effectively.

Mark Howarth, Heveco's local managing director, said: 'Our facility has already received approval from blue-chip companies who have been impressed with our approach.' Heveco Ltd's chairman Ton Derks addedd 'The UK market is one that requires its suppliers to be both multi-faceted and competitive. We believe that this new facility adds to Heveco's strength in the UK and is a welcome addition to its ongoing investment programme.'
